Description of CAY10485

Acyl-coenzyme A: cholesterol acyltransferase-1 and -2 (ACAT-1 and ACAT-2) catalyze the formation of cholesterol esters from cholesterol and long chain fatty acyl-coenzyme A, and may play a role in the development of atherosclerosis. CAY10485 inhibits human ACAT-1 and ACAT-2 with an IC50 values of 95 and 81 µM, respectively. It also inhibits copper-mediated oxidation of low density lipoproteins by 91% at a concentration of 2 µM.

Chemical Properties of CAY10485

Cas No. 615264-62-5 SDF
Synonyms 3,4dihydroxy Hydrocinnamic acid (LAspartic acid dibenzyl ester) amide
Canonical SMILES O=C(CCc1ccc(O)c(O)c1)N[C@@H](CC(=O)OCc1ccccc1)C(=O)OCc1ccccc1
Formula C27H27NO7 M.Wt 477.5
Solubility DMF: 20 mg/ml,DMSO: 20 mg/ml,Ethanol: 20 mg/ml,Ethanol:PBS (pH 7.2)(1:3): .25 mg/ml Storage Store at -20°C
